Aromas of cassis and ripe blackberries with sweet spices and grilled herbs. Some wet earth, too. Medium-bodied with polished tannins, crunchy acidity and hints of bitter spices and chocolate to close. Drink or hold.
Wild raspberries, plums, Oreos and some oregano on the nose. It’s medium-bodied, bright and tasty, with fine-grained tannins. Subtle spices. Sustainable. Drink now and enjoy. Screw cap.

A very textured chardonnay here with a subtle creamy layer to the lemon zest and minerals, with just a hint of herbs. Chalky and fresh on the palate with really attractive green fruit. Drink or hold.

Crushed blackberries, dried herbs, spices and flowers. A round yet fleshy and juicy delivery of malbec and bonarda, delivering richness as well as drinkability. Pretty long, too. Drink or hold.
